As per The Standard, Chelsea have designated the 20-year-old as one of their main transfer targets; internally with the signing of a striker also being considered. The Blues made an early inquiry for Diomande, but Sporting turned it down, stating they would only sell him for his release clause of £69 million (€80 million).

Despite having Trevoh Chalobah, Benoit Badiashile, Axel Disasi, Wesley Fofana, Levi Colwill, and Thiago Silva on the roster, Chelsea wants to add another young central defender. Chalobah is available for sale in January to help fund new purchases, while Silva could leave when his contract expires this summer and Fofana is out with a long-term knee injury.

Vitor Gyokeres, a striker for Sporting, has also drawn interest from Chelsea. In his debut season with the Portuguese side, the former Brighton and Coventry City target man has 17 goals and 8 assists in 20 games. Sporting is once more unwilling to sell their star forward and has insisted that any interested parties cover the entirety of his £87 million (€100 million) release clause.
